Levitsky et al.[41] defined a process for identifying eukaryotic promoter regions genes with an presentation on D. melanogaster . Its uniqueness based on recognizing the genetic algorithms to explore an optimal divider of a promoter area into local nonoverlapping pieces, and choosing the most distinct dinucleotide occurrences for such fragments.
